Steps to change the light bulbs:
Removing old lightbulbs
• Make sure the range hood is unplugged or turn OFF the electrical breaker. Remove the two aluminum mesh filters.
• Reach inside range hood body and place one hand above the metal bracket and with two fingers
gently push down on the socket area. (See Fig #6). Note: Range hood and Lightbulbs may have very sharp edges;
please wear protective gloves if it is necessary to remove any parts for installing, cleaning or servicing.
• So as not to accidently break the glass, gently place two fingers from second hand onto the surface
of the light bulb. (See Fig #6) Gently turn the lightbulb counter clockwise to loosen and unlock lightbulb from socket.
Once unlocked the lightbulb should come out freely.
Installing new lightbulbs
• With your new lightbulb in one hand, ensure the bulb prongs are lined up with the wide ends of the two slots located in the socket.
• Slip lightbulb into the wide ends of the two slots and turn clockwise until a locked position is apparent. (See Fig #7)
Note: Do not push too hard as the lightbulb prongs may break off.
• Turn ON electrical breaker and range hood to test for operation.

This range hood uses halogen bulbs: 20W 120V Type GU-10
